Output 3e40304622b925e6925e9bd4dc2e0844c7185c624ab85ae66b1590e14f1af230:17

value
426111730
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 341984aedc2bb8d33f81ad8ee090b52495fff802 OP_EQUALVERIFY OP_CHECKSIG
address
15kUi217HKEYYDVfTY4N2cRBQTDSSUKNzJ
transaction
3e40304622b925e6925e9bd4dc2e0844c7185c624ab85ae66b1590e14f1af230
spent
true